Under the current legal framework, circulating viral "MMS leaks" is treated as a major cybercrime. The Bharatiya Nyaya Sanhita (BNS), alongside the stringent IT Act, 2000, mandates that individuals who record, upload, or share non-consensual intimate videos face multiple years of imprisonment and heavy fines. Section 66E of the IT Act specifically addresses the violation of privacy by capturing, publishing, or transmitting images of a private area without consent, an offense that can lead to imprisonment and financial penalties. Additionally, the distribution falls under the classification of "obscene" and "sexually explicit" material as defined in Sections 67 and 67A of the IT Act.
